Interface ManagementRegistrar<R>

All Known Subinterfaces:
ResourceDefinitionProvider
All Known Implementing Classes:
AddStepHandler, DefaultSubsystemDescribeHandler, DeploymentChainContributingAddStepHandler, DeploymentChainContributingResourceRegistrar, MetricHandler, OperationHandler, ReloadRequiredAddStepHandler, ReloadRequiredRemoveStepHandler, ReloadRequiredResourceRegistrar, RemoveStepHandler, ResourceRegistrar, RestartParentResourceAddStepHandler, RestartParentResourceRegistrar, RestartParentResourceRemoveStepHandler, RestartParentResourceWriteAttributeHandler, SimpleResourceRegistrar, SubsystemResourceDefinition, WriteAttributeStepHandler

public interface ManagementRegistrar<R>
Implemented by a management artifact that can register itself. This allows a management object to encapsulates specific registration details (e.g. resource aliases) from the parent resource.
Author:
Paul Ferraro
  • Method Summary

    Modifier and Type
    Method
    Description
    void
    register(R registration)
    Registers this object with a resource.
  • Method Details

    • register

      void register(R registration)
      Registers this object with a resource.
      Parameters:
      registration - a registration for a management resource